+/**
+ * check for kernel features (currently only via version number)
+ */
+static void check_kernel_features(private_kernel_netlink_net_t *this)
+{
+ struct utsname utsname;
+ int a, b, c;
+
+ if (uname(&utsname) == 0)
+ {
+ switch(sscanf(utsname.release, "%d.%d.%d", &a, &b, &c))
+ {
+ case 3:
+ if (a == 2)
+ {
+ DBG2(DBG_KNL, "detected Linux %d.%d.%d, no support for "
+ "RTA_PREFSRC for IPv6 routes", a, b, c);
+ break;
+ }
+ /* fall-through */
+ case 2:
+ /* only 3.x+ uses two part version numbers */
+ this->rta_prefsrc_for_ipv6 = TRUE;
+ break;
+ default:
+ break;
+ }
+ }
+}
